Here, we discuss the primary responsibilities associated with each role, along with their demand in the current job market and the average salary ranges. 1. **Data Scientist**: In IoT sustainability, data scientists analyze vast amounts of data generated by IoT devices to help organizations make informed and eco-friendly decisions. The role requires expertise in statistical analysis, data visualization, and machine learning. With a median salary of £50,000 to £75,000, the demand for experienced data scientists remains high. 2. **Software Engineer**: Software engineers in the IoT sustainability field develop software applications and systems that manage and analyze IoT data. They must be proficient in programming languages such as Python, Java, and C++. A software engineer's average salary ranges from £40,000 to £60,000, with an increasing demand for those who specialize in IoT and sustainability. 3. **IoT Architect**: IoT architects design and implement IoT infrastructure for organizations, ensuring seamless integration of IoT devices and data management systems. They require a deep understanding of IoT protocols, network architectures, and security measures. The average salary for IoT architects ranges between £60,000 and £90,000, with a growing demand for professionals with sustainability expertise. 4. **Sustainability Consultant**: Sustainability consultants help businesses optimize their operations for environmental efficiency, including the adoption of IoT technologies. They provide strategic guidance on resource management and reduction initiatives. These professionals earn salaries between £35,000 and £60,000, with an increasing awareness of the importance of sustainability in organizations. 5. **Product Manager**: Product managers in the IoT sustainability sector oversee the development and launch of sustainable IoT products and services. They need strong leadership skills, strategic thinking, and a solid understanding of IoT technologies and sustainability principles. Product managers typically earn between £45,000 and £80,000, with a growing emphasis on eco-friendly product development.
